Carbon Tennis Takes Down Rabbits

Victorious Lady Dinos Secure Fourth Place in Region 12 Tennis Standings

The Carbon High School Lady Dinos tennis team hosted the Delta Rabbits on Tuesday for a crucial region match. Despite some closely contested matchups, the Lady Dinos emerged victorious, securing four wins to Delta's two.

Thrilling Showdown as Lady Dinos Cement Their Position in the Region

Singles Showdown: Grit and Determination on Display

In the singles matches, the Lady Dinos showcased their resilience and skill. In the first singles match, Ireland Keil engaged in a hard-fought three-set battle, ultimately falling to her opponent in the decisive third set, 6-4. However, Leah Sweeney quickly dispatched her opponent in the second singles match, winning both sets convincingly, 6-2. Mandy Riggs also secured a victory in her singles match, triumphing in two sets with scores of 6-1 and 6-4.

Doubles Duels: Nail-biting Finishes and Clutch Performances

The doubles matches proved to be equally thrilling. Emme Stockdale and Kiley Sasser pushed their opponents to the limit, but ultimately fell in the third set, 6-3. In a closely contested affair, Gianna Valdez and Cecily Riley emerged victorious in the third set, 6-3. The dynamic duo of Abby Tharp and Kamberlee Hoffman secured a hard-fought win in two sets, with the final set ending in a tiebreaker, 7-6 (13-11).

Climbing the Region 12 Standings: A Promising Outlook

The Lady Dinos' impressive performance has propelled them to fourth place in the Region 12 standings, with a region record of 4-3. They trail the undefeated Juab Wasps (6-0), the North Sanpete Hawks (6-1), and the Richfield Wildcats (5-2).
